Frequently asked questions about Central Middle School
How many students attend Central Middle School?
Central Middle School has 469 students enrolled. It is a middle school in Waterloo, IA. CCD year-over-year: 471 (2022-23) → 466 (2023-24), nearly flat (-5).
What is the student-teacher ratio at Central Middle School?
The student-teacher ratio at Central Middle School is 13.4:1, which is 9% lower than the Iowa average of 14.8:1 and 15% lower than the national average of 15.7:1. Lower ratios generally mean more individual attention per student.
What percentage of students receive free lunch at Central Middle School?
76.6% of students at Central Middle School are eligible for free lunch, compared to the Iowa average of 36.4%.
What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Central Middle School?
The largest demographic group at Central Middle School is African American at 34.1% of enrollment, in Waterloo, IA. Its student body is more racially and ethnically mixed than most US schools, with a diversity index of 77.0/100.
What is the Resource Investment Index for Central Middle School?
Central Middle School has a Resource Investment Index of 42/100 (typical reported resources relative to schools nationally) based on 4 factors: student-teacher ratio, gifted-program reporting, counselor availability, chronic absenteeism.
